Weather resistant and suitable for door thicknesses of 30-60mm, the Keylex high security combination lock can facilitate codes up to 12 digits long, offering incredible security. Not only does this mean the possibility of different combinations is radically increased, but is also very useful for settings where codes may be overseen when entered, as codes longer than the usual 4 digits become much more difficult to memorise on-the-fly.
This code lock also features a passage-mode setting. This allows you to put the door in free-operation mode, so no code would be required to enter. This can be very useful in rooms or buildings where free entry is required at times, but only coded access the rest of the time.
The buttons on the unit are made with a brushed stainless steel, to reduce obvious indication of use, in an effort to avoid the common issue of keys showing obvious signs of use, and in addition, there's a slipping clutch mechanism within the unit to help prevent damage being caused to the unit by force being applied to the handle after an incorrect code.
Offering key override via a euro-cylinder (not included), this also offers protection for you against lost codes etc, ensuring you can still gain entry via key until such time as the lost code or any other code issue has been resolved. The centres measurement for this is a common 72mm PZ.
